net_sched: sch_fq: change fq_flow size/layout

sizeof(struct fq_flow) is 112 bytes on 64bit arches.

This means that half of them use two cache lines, but 50% use
three cache lines.

This patch adds cache line alignment, and makes sure that only
the first cache line is touched by fq_enqueue(), which is more
expensive that fq_dequeue() in general.
